In recognition
of its environmental leadership and comprehensive disclosure in the area of
climate change, Siemens has been included by the CDP on its annual Climate
Change A List, the highest possible performance ranking. CDP is a leading organization
evaluating corporate action on climate strategies. The non-profit assessed more
than 21,000 companies on the basis of data reported in its 2023 climate change
questionnaire. Siemens is one of the few companies to have received an “A” rating.

For the first time ever, an industrial product has been certified for the United States
after parts of the required tests were conducted through digital simulation. That
simulation was verified and validated with physical testing. This remarkable
achievement is a global first in a national safety-certification process. To make this
advance possible, Siemens collaborated with UL Solutions, an esteemed global
leader in applied safety science. The result is a testimony to the remarkable
accuracy and reliability of modern digital twin simulations. It marks a step forward
into a future in which digital twins and the industrial metaverse streamlines product
development, enhances innovation, safety and accelerates time-to-market.

- New V6 software generation with new functions like a single positioner to reduce the load of the controller, and EtherNet/IP to allow third-party controllers to be connected
- Simulation via DriveSim Advanced enables virtual commissioning in advance, ensuring drive process requirements are met efficiently and cost-effectively
- New hardware architecture with functional enhancements like a second encoder interface and 3C3 (H2S and SO2) coating increases precision and robustness
Siemens is innovating the well-established Sinamics S210 servo drive system with a new hardware architecture and new V6 software generation that expand the system's range of applications. The servo drive system is especially suitable for applications with high dynamics in the power range between 50 W and 7 kW: for example, machines for packaging, pick & place applications, and digital printing.

Siemens AG
has completed the acquisition of Heliox, a technology leader in DC fast
charging solutions, serving eBus and eTruck fleets and passenger vehicles. Headquartered
in the Netherlands, Heliox employs approximately 330 people.
